WATTS,
Ray E.
Ray E. Watts, age 75, of Globe AZ, passed away on Monday, Dec. 29, 2003, at Cobre Valley Community Hospital.
He was born on September 18, 1928 in Baxter County, Arkansas, the son of Lillie Mae (Dean) and Edward F. Watts.
A Korean War Army veteran and recipient of Korean Service Medal with Three Bronze Service Stars and the United Nations Service Medal. Ray worked for BHP Copper for 38 years as a production foreman. A member of Word of Life Assembly of God in Miami, Ray was an usher and the pastor's right-hand man. An avid reader, he studied scripture. He also volunteered at the election polls. His favorite times were spent with his family, grandchildren and the family's pets. He enjoyed cooking and made the best guacamole in the west. He will be missed by all who knew and loved him and will remain forever in their hearts.
Left behind in loving memory are: his wife of 23 years, Livi (Gonzales) Watts, whom he married May 28, 1980; 4 sons, Stan Watts (Suzanne Dohrer) of Phoenix Az, Mark Hazelette of Phoenix Az, Christopher Hazelett of Globe Az, and Robert (Kristin) Hazelett of Globe Az; 4 grandsons, Joshua Stephen Watts, Zachary Matthew Watts, Jacob Andrew Watts and Thaddeus Jonathan Hazelett; sister-in-law, Omega Watts; brothers-in-law Robert (Dottie) Gonzales, John Gonzales, Tony Gonzales, Henry (Petra) Gonzales and Jim Gonzales. Extended family member, Heather LeMieux; 1st wife Martha Burline Crites and numerous nieces and nephews also survive him. His son, Jonathan "Caravella" Hazelett, his parents, three brothers and two sisters preceded him in death.
